DELIGHT AS COLAISTE AILIGH CLAIM FIRST ALL-IRELAND TITLE

written by Stephen Maguire January 22, 2013

Colaiste Ailigh of Letterkenny are celebrating after they won the school’s first All-Ireland title today.

The school’s Under 16 basketball team beat off stiff opposition from PSN Baldoyle to win the national title at the National Basketball Arena in Dublin this afternoon by 39-34.

Manager and teacher Seosamh McKelvey said he was very proud of his team and the school who travelled to the game in huge numbers.

“We always knew we had it in us to win it and thankfully we performed on the day. It’s a great occasion and I’m very proud of the team and of the entire school.

“We had greats support and there’s going to be great celebrations as a result,” h said.

Although McKelvey said it was very much a team effort, a number of players had tremendous games.

They include captain Oisin Cleary who scored no less than 15 points and John McIntyre who bagged 9 points.

The school is having a huge homecoming for the team at the school this evening.
